Does Turkey Accept Israel As A Country?

Israel–Turkey relations were formalized in March 1949, when Turkey was the first Muslim majority country to recognize the State of Israel.

How many Turkish are in Israel?

Turkish Jews in Israel are immigrants and descendants of the immigrants of the Turkish Jewish communities, who now reside within the State of Israel. They number around 100,000-150,000.

Does China recognize Israel?

However, China did not establish normal diplomatic relations with Israel until 1992. Since then, Israel and China have developed increasingly close economic, military and technological links with each other.

Why Pakistan do not accept Israel?

Pakistan’s religiously-oriented political parties such as Jamaat-e-Islami and militant groups such as Lashkar-e-Taiba fiercely oppose any relationship with Israel, and have repeatedly called for the destruction of Israel due to its standing as an alleged sworn enemy of Pakistan.

What are Turkish Jews called?

Sephardi Jews make up approximately 96% of Turkey’s Jewish population, while the rest are primarily Ashkenazi Jews and Jews from Italian extraction. There is also a small community of Romaniote Jews and the community of the Constantinopolitan Karaites who are related to each other.

Who buys weapons from Israel?

Much of the exports are sold to the United States and Europe. Other major regions that purchase Israeli defense equipment include Southeast Asia and Latin America. India is also major country for Israeli arms exports and has remained Israel’s largest arms market in the world.

Is Israel in NATO?

The alliance offers an arena through which Israel could strengthen its ties with democracies and with Mediterranean countries, including Turkey. Israel has enjoyed a special relationship with NATO for over three decades and was the third country to gain non-NATO alliance status as early as 1989.

Can Israelis go to Egypt?

So, can Israelis visit Egypt? Yes, but like all other nationalities, Israelis need to have a valid passport and a valid visa. Egypt is a popular “get away” destination for countless Israelis, but many simply cross over the border via the Taba border crossing to avoid the hassle of having to obtain a visa.

Can Israel go to Qatar?

Israelis will be able to enter Qatar for the 2022 World Cup event in November, several officials announced in a joint statement on Thursday. This will mark the first time Israelis are accepted into Qatar without using a foreign passport.

Can Israel go to Saudi Arabia?

Under the 1954 Israeli Prevention of Infiltration Law, Lebanon, Egypt, Syria, Saudi Arabia, Jordan, Iraq and Yemen were designated “enemy states”. Israeli citizens may not visit countries so designated without a permit issued by the Israeli Interior Ministry.
